The Intersection of Global Water Issues and ALS Disparities

Access to clean and safe water is uneven around the world, highlighting stark disparities that have significant health implications. ALS, a neurodegenerative disease impacting the nerve cells in the brain and spinal cord, has been linked in some studies to environmental toxins found in contaminated water sources. These ALS disparities raise important questions about the role of water quality in public health.
The Link Between Water Contamination and ALS
Scientific interest in the connection between water contamination and ALS has increased over the years. Areas with higher exposure to pollutants like heavy metals and pesticides often correlate with higher ALS incidence. Pollutants are not always visible to the naked eye, which can make them a silent killer. The potential link between these toxins and ALS symptom development suggests a need for further research and action.

Socioeconomic Factors and ALS Risks
Socioeconomic status plays a significant role in determining water quality access. Low-income communities often reside in areas with increased environmental contamination, elevating their risk for developing diseases linked to poor water quality, such as ALS. These communities face a dual burden of limited resources and increased health risks.
The cost of improving infrastructure in these areas can be prohibitive, leaving many trapped in a cycle of poverty and illness. Advocacy for equitable resource distribution and increased governmental intervention is vital for resolving these disparities.
